Devils Fog

where did you say you're from?
south Dakota or freezing New York? 
I ain't got a dime to spare you,
but I'll offer you a ride on my wagon.

you better not be staying here long, 
have you heard the humours about 
the fog? 
thick as night on a bright sunny 
spot,
mutilated cattles but not a single 
drop of blood! 

and then we have those ghostly 
shucks!
for centuries these parts have no 
history of red eyes coyotes,
and what about those eerie lights 
hovering at devils arc, 
too steep for any mortal man to 
climb and mess around.

if you're new in these part of town,
wait no more and get the hell out 
fast,
no one here gonna take your word,
even if you say you saw Elvis here!

I'll be Damm if you live to see the 
next day,
and now sunny what did you say 
your name was?
my mommy used to warned me not 
to pick up strangers,
she used to say they could be the 
red eye demons.

why just last week my neighbour 
jimmy,
got his neck snaped back like dried 
old sticks,
and he's 6 foot 300 pound massive 
fellow!
rumours had it that he pick up 
some stranger in these woods 

say I forgot to ask you something 
boy, 
just where are you heading to? 
oh shucks and what ill time to have,
here comes those Damm thick fog 
now.....
